What is Medical Malpractice?
Hospitals, doctors, nurses, and related members of the medical field are expected to provide a certain standard of care to their patients. Medical malpractice occurs when the healthcare professional subsequently breaks that standard of care and injures a patient through either negligence or an act of omission. According to the Medical Malpractice Centre, between 15,000 and 19,000 medical malpractice suits are filed in the United States each year.
Examples of negligence that may lead to medical malpractice include:
- Misdiagnosis or delayed diagnosis
- Failure to diagnose
- Failure to order appropriate tests
- Operating on the wrong limb
- Leaving equipment or other items inside the patient after surgery
- Improper care before or after surgery
- Premature discharge
- Neglect leading to bedsores
- Childbirth injuries (to either the mother or child)

How Much Can I Recover for a Medical Injury in Washington?
The amount of compensation you may receive for a medical injury will be different for each unique case and will depend on a number of factors; for example, your compensation amount will depend on the severity of your injuries, as well as the extent of your loss of enjoyment of life or activities. No attorney can guarantee the amount of money you will receive; however, the right attorney will be able to aid you in getting the maximum amount of compensation available in your case.
Washington does not currently have damage caps when it comes to medical malpractice cases, but there is a statute of limitations to how long you are able to bring a personal injury lawsuit; the statute of limitations is the time limit you have to file a suit before your claim is barred from receiving compensation. In Washington, the statute of limitations is 3 years; this means that you have 3 years from the date of the injury to file a lawsuit.
